Good to know

  • Rental age requirements generally aren't a one-size-fits-all. Providers can set their own policies, and if you're a younger driver, you could be hit with extra charges or rules. Check what applies with each supplier before booking your car rental in Belgium.

  • Kids coming with you? Car seat requirements vary depending on where you are, and the correct setup may depend on their weight, height and age. Confirm whether you need to add one to your CRL car rental booking.

  • You'll need to bring a few things when picking up your rental car: your physical driver's licence, extra photo ID, and a credit card with enough funds for the security deposit. Debit cards aren't commonly accepted. Your booking will show the full list of what's required.

  • Familiarise yourself with your rental. Check your seat and mirrors, learn where everything is, and get comfortable with its handling before you set off. And importantly, stick to the right side of the road in Belgium.

  • Make sure you stay within the local speed limits. Most of the time that's around 45kph in built-up areas and 110kph or so on highways, unless signs say otherwise.

  • In Belgium, the legal blood alcohol concentration (BAC) limit is 0.05%. If you intend to drink, get someone else to do the driving or find a safe alternative way to get around.

  • The euro (EUR) is the currency you'll be using for day-to-day purchases and outings. Use cards when it's convenient, and keep some cash handy when electronic payments aren't available.

Drive smarter from the start

  • After you've grabbed the keys to your CRL car hire, it's time to create your own itinerary. Central Brussels is about 56 kilometres north and a drive of around 55 minutes if that's your first stop.

  • The drive from Brussels S. Charleroi to the city centre during rush hour can take up to 1 hour 50 minutes.

  • One of the busiest times to be out on the roads in this destination is around 8am. Make things easy by driving outside rush hours in general.

Hit the road: Where to drive from Brussels S. Charleroi (CRL)

  • Explore some of the major attractions in Brussels before you do anything else. Grand Place and Atomium set you up for a memorable trip.

  • Charleroi should be on your itinerary if you're eager to see Musée de la Photographie and BPS22, Musee d'art de la Province de Hainaut. This city is about 5 kilometres south of CRL.

  • Or collect your Brussels S. Charleroi car hire and set out for Liege. Roughly 80 kilometres east of the airport, Cathedral de Liege (Liege Cathedral) and Parc De La Citadelle are among the highlights that are worth going out of your way for.

  • Why slow down now? Cruise on over to Arlon, around 129 kilometres southeast of CRL. From Archaeological Museum of Arlon to Eglise Saint-Donat, it makes for a well-rounded adventure.
